Simply translated, Kokedama means “Moss Ball” which is basically a ball of Soil covered with Moss, on which an ornamental plant grows. They are also referred to as String gardens wherein they can be hung with a string or alternatively can sit in a shallow dish, adding to the beauty of window or tabletop.
